ITEM: A timeless antique Art Deco diamond engagement ring dating to the 1930s, beautifully crafted in platinum and designed with the elegant geometric simplicity that makes Art Deco jewelry so enduring.

 

At the center of the ring is a 0.68 carat round brilliant-cut diamond, securely held in a classic prong setting. The center stone is framed by beautifully balanced shoulders, each featuring a bezel-set marquise-cut diamond paired with a round single-cut diamond. The combination of geometric shapes and contrasting settings creates a refined look that feels distinctly Art Deco while remaining effortlessly timeless.

CARAT: (1) 0.68 carat natural Diamond, (2) 0.04 carat Diamonds, and (2) 0.015 carat Diamonds. 

 

CUT: (1) Round Brilliant Cut Diamond, (2) Marquis Cut Diamonds, and (2) Round Single Cut Diamonds. 

 

COLOR: G - H 

 

CLARITY: The major Diamond is VVS2 and the accent Diamonds are VS1 - VS2. 

 

MATERIAL: Platinum 

 

RING SIZE: 4.75
